How Sylfirm X Works

Standard RF microneedling devices deliver radiofrequency energy continuously through insulated needles to heat the dermis. Sylfirm X does this as well, but it adds a second mode: pulsed wave (PW) delivery. This distinction matters clinically.

The pulsed wave mode allows the device to selectively target abnormal blood vessels and overactive melanocyte clusters without indiscriminately heating surrounding tissue. This selectivity is what makes Sylfirm X effective for vascular concerns and pigment disorders that other RF devices are not suited to treat, and in some cases can worsen.

The continuous wave (CW) mode delivers sustained heat into the mid-dermis to stimulate fibroblast activity, promote neocollagenesis, and contract existing collagen fibers. Both modes use non-insulated needles that penetrate up to 4 millimeters for direct energy delivery with controlled surface impact.

Eight programmable modes allow the provider to configure the device for the specific concern being addressed in a given session. Treatments can be adapted to pigmentation, laxity, vascular redness, or textural irregularity based on the individual patient presentation.

What Sylfirm X Treats

Melasma and Pigmentation

Melasma is notoriously difficult to manage with standard RF microneedling because the heat involved can trigger additional melanin production. Sylfirm X addresses this through its pulsed wave mode, which targets hyperactive melanocytes and the abnormal vasculature that feeds them. It also repairs the basement membrane, which plays a role in long-term pigment stability.

Clinical data associated with the technology shows meaningful reductions in melasma severity scores across multiple sessions. A typical protocol for melasma involves three to four sessions spaced four weeks apart. Individual results may vary based on melasma type, skin tone, and sun exposure habits.

Jawline, Jowls, and Lower Face Laxity

Sylfirm X is particularly effective for the early-to-moderate laxity that develops along the jawline and in the jowl area. The radiofrequency energy contracts fibrous septa and triggers dermal remodeling. Over time, this produces a visible firming effect along the jaw contour.

Results typically become visible between four and twelve weeks after a session, with the most significant improvement appearing around three months as new collagen matures. Results from a full protocol can persist for twelve to eighteen months with appropriate maintenance. Individual results may vary.

Neck and Periorbital Area

The precision of Sylfirm X makes it one of the few RF microneedling platforms considered safe for the periorbital area, including the skin beneath and around the eyes. The finer needles and controlled energy delivery reduce the risk of unwanted thermal injury in this sensitive zone. This opens treatment options for crepiness and fine lines in areas that most aggressive devices cannot safely address.

Early Skin Laxity and Preventative Tightening

For clients in their mid-thirties to late forties who are noticing the first signs of collagen loss, Sylfirm X functions as a precision maintenance treatment. Rather than waiting for laxity to become pronounced, proactive treatment sessions help maintain skin architecture and delay the onset of more significant sagging. The combination of immediate collagen contraction and longer-term neocollagenesis produces progressive improvement over multiple sessions.

Sylfirm X Compared to Other RF Microneedling Devices

Choosing an RF microneedling device is not a one-size decision. Different platforms are engineered with different goals. Understanding how Sylfirm X compares to other commonly offered devices helps clarify which is appropriate for a given concern.

RF Microneedling Device Comparison
Feature Sylfirm X Morpheus8 Secret RF Sublative RF Potenza
RF Delivery Modes Dual wave (PW + CW) Continuous only Continuous only Fractional, non-invasive Customizable, no PW
Needle Depth Up to 4mm Up to 8mm Up to 3.5mm Epidermal only Variable
Best Suited For Melasma, rosacea, early laxity, jowls, vascular pigment Deep laxity, fat contouring, pronounced volume loss Pore refinement, texture, mild tightening Surface texture, fine lines General rejuvenation, scarring
Downtime 1 to 3 days 3 to 7 days 2 to 5 days Hours to 1 day 1 to 3 days
Comfort Level Minimal with topical numbing Moderate to significant Moderate Gentle Moderate
Melasma Safety Appropriate — PW targets root cause Not recommended — heat may worsen pigment Limited benefit Minimal benefit Moderate, no PW mode
Periorbital Safety Yes, with appropriate settings Not typically used near eyes Limited Superficial only Limited
Sessions Needed 3 on average More for contouring 3 to 4 4 to 6 3 to 4

Morpheus8 reaches deeper tissue levels and may be appropriate for patients with more pronounced volume loss and structural laxity. However, its deeper energy delivery carries greater risk of fat atrophy and is not recommended for vascular or pigment disorders. Sylfirm X preserves subdermal volume while achieving meaningful dermal remodeling.

Sublative RF operates at the epidermal level, making it effective for fine surface texture and minimal downtime recovery, but it does not address deeper laxity or vascular pigment issues the way Sylfirm X does.

Potenza and Secret RF offer solid general rejuvenation results but lack the pulsed wave capability that makes Sylfirm X distinctively useful for melasma, rosacea, and vascular irregularity.

What to Expect from a Sylfirm X Treatment Protocol

Most clients complete three sessions spaced four to six weeks apart. Some concerns, particularly melasma, may require a fourth session depending on depth and distribution of pigment.

Before treatment, a topical anesthetic is applied and allowed to absorb. The treatment itself typically takes thirty to forty-five minutes depending on the area covered. Mild redness and minor swelling are expected for one to three days after each session. These are signs of normal dermal response and resolve without intervention.

Early improvements in skin texture and tone often appear within one to two weeks of the first session. Collagen remodeling continues for three to six months, with the most visible lift and firmness appearing around the three-month mark. Annual maintenance sessions are commonly recommended to preserve results.

Who Is a Good Candidate for Sylfirm X

Sylfirm X is appropriate for a wide range of skin tones and types. Its controlled energy delivery makes it one of the few RF microneedling devices with a favorable safety profile for Fitzpatrick skin types III through VI, which are typically at higher risk for post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ation with heat-based treatments.

Ideal candidates for Sylfirm X include individuals with:

  • Early to moderate skin laxity along the jawline, neck, or cheeks
  • Melasma or vascular-driven pigmentation
  • Acne scarring combined with active redness or rosacea
  • Fine lines in the periorbital or perioral area
  • A preference for minimal social downtime
  • Skin that has not responded well to more aggressive treatments in the past

Candidates who are pregnant, actively managing certain skin infections, or taking medications that affect wound healing are not appropriate for RF microneedling. A clinical consultation will identify any contraindications specific to your health history.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Sylfirm X the same as standard RF microneedling?

No. Standard RF microneedling devices deliver radiofrequency energy in a continuous wave, which heats the dermis uniformly. Sylfirm X adds a pulsed wave mode that selectively targets abnormal vasculature and overactive pigment cells. This dual-wave capability makes it effective for conditions like melasma and rosacea that continuous-only devices cannot safely address.

How many Sylfirm X sessions are needed?

Most treatment protocols involve three sessions spaced four to six weeks apart. Melasma and more complex pigment concerns may benefit from a fourth session. Maintenance sessions annually are typically recommended to sustain collagen-related improvements. Individual protocols are determined at consultation.

How does Sylfirm X compare to Morpheus8 for jowls?

Morpheus8 reaches deeper tissue at up to 8 millimeters and may be better suited for patients with pronounced structural laxity or significant fat pad displacement. Sylfirm X addresses early to moderate jowl definition with less downtime and a lower risk of subdermal fat atrophy. The appropriate choice depends on the degree of laxity and your provider’s clinical assessment. Individual results may vary.

Is Sylfirm X safe for darker skin tones?

Yes. Sylfirm X has a favorable safety profile for Fitzpatrick skin types III through VI because its pulsed wave mode targets selectively rather than applying uniform heat. This reduces the risk of post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ation that can occur with other RF devices. Your provider will confirm candidacy based on your specific skin presentation and history.
